Alternate Delegate’s Role & Responsibilities
The Alternate Delegate prepares to assume the Delegate’s responsibilities should the Delegate be unable to continue any duty. He or she presides at the Area Committee meeting, assists the Delegate whenever needed, sets up and coordinates the Area 33 GSR school, coordinates Area 33 GSR District workshops, Pre-Conference, Service Fair, reviews and edits Area Assembly minutes received from Secretary and maintains Area 33 communications with past delegates.
Area Officers
The Area Officers consist of the Delegate, Alternate Delegate, Chairperson, Treasurer, Registrar, Secretary, and Records Secretary.
The Area Officers serve a two-year term beginning in the odd years. Elections are held in the preceding October. The elections are conducted by third-legacy procedure as described earlier in this guide and in The Service Manual. The outgoing Delegate chairs the Area Officer elections and forwards the results to the General Service Office. Voting members are the GSRs, DCMs, Area Committee Chairs, and Area Officers. Alternate GSRs and DCMs are also voting members in the absence of the GSR or DCM.
Delegate’s Role & Responsibilities
The Delegate carries the collective conscience of Area 33 to the General Service Conference each year and reports the events of the conference to the Area Assembly. He or she attends all area, state and regional service meetings, helps the area and the General Service Office obtain financial support, is an ex-officio member of all Area committees; obtains information from GSO, provides A.A. leadership in solving local problems involving A.A. traditions, visits groups and districts in the area, works closely with the area officers, keeps the Alternate Delegate informed, and, late in the term, works with the Delegate-elect and new Area Officers.

Chairperson’s Role & Responsibilities
The Chairperson (Chair) coordinates the Area Assembly, prepares the agenda for and chairs the Area Assembly meeting, communicates with the Area committees for monthly presentations and is responsible for the rotation of districts providing Area Assembly set up and snacks (lunch). The Chair has the responsibility of contacting Committee Chairs and Area Officers who have not shown up or had contact with the Chair for three (3) consecutive months. He or she coordinates Area office usage and monitors who has keys to the office.

Treasurer’s Role & Responsibilities
The Treasurer receives and deposits all group contributions, pays all bills incurred for Area 33, maintains all financial records and ledgers, maintains current IRS and legal information for non-profit status, provides a verbal and written report at the Area Assembly, and is a member of the Finance Committee. The treasurer is also responsible after his or her legacy to serve as one of the members of the Finance Committee.

The Secretary handles all the correspondence for Area 33, maintains a current Area electronic mailing list, produces and emails the minutes of the Area Assembly, maintains Area 33 Officer and Committee databases, and produces bulletins (as instructed). The Secretary is also responsible for taking notes at the Officer meetings, 11:00 a.m. DCM meetings, as well as the 11:00 a.m. Area Committee meetings.

Records Secretary’s Role & Responsibilities
The Records Secretary advises the Area members on Area Guidelines policy and procedures, maintains a current Area 3 3 mailing list, gets the minutes from the printing company and mails them, and maintains an archival records library for the Area minutes and Area Workshops. He or she also serves as a back-up and support to the Area Secretary and is responsible for maintaining (printing) and updating (as instructed) the Area 33 Guidelines.
